An urban marvel of its time, the Indus Valley Civilization (Mohenjo‑Daro, Harappa) featured advanced city planning, standardized bricks, drainage systems, and trade links to Mesopotamia. Despite its sophistication, its script remains undeciphered.With the arrival of Indo-Aryans came Sanskrit, the hymns of the Rigveda, rituals, the roots of Hindu beliefs, and philosophical traditions that matured through the Upanishads. Cultural achievements include Panini’s grammar and developments in Ayurveda.Sixteen powerful regional kingdoms—Mahajanapadas—emerged across the Gangetic plains. This transformative period saw the births of Buddhism and Jainism and the rise of political centers like Magadha.
